Bin Gao is a scholar working on Electrical and Electronic Engineering, Renewable Energy, Sustainability and the Environment and Materials Chemistry. According to data from OpenAlex, Bin Gao has authored 56 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Electrical and Electronic Engineering, 35 papers in Renewable Energy, Sustainability and the Environment and 25 papers in Materials Chemistry. Recurrent topics in Bin Gao’s work include Advanced Photocatalysis Techniques (26 papers), Advancements in Battery Materials (18 papers) and Advanced battery technologies research (18 papers). Bin Gao is often cited by papers focused on Advanced Photocatalysis Techniques (26 papers), Advancements in Battery Materials (18 papers) and Advanced battery technologies research (18 papers). Bin Gao collaborates with scholars based in China, Japan and Singapore. Bin Gao's co-authors include Tao Wang, Jianping He, Hao Gong, Xiaoli Fan, Hairong Xue, Hu Guo, Wei Xia, Xianli Huang, Cheng Jiang and Li Song and has published in prestigious journals such as Angewandte Chemie International Edition, Langmuir and Advanced Energy Materials.
